Went to go view an Audi A3 that they had for sale recently for a mate. Nice and well presented showroom, cars were all prepped well and the A3 was exactly as described. Ended up not buying as my mate decided against the extra running costs of the s line and went for a non s line from elsewhere. As traders in Bradford go, they seemed pretty decent. Non of the stereotypical wide boy salesman stuff. From the brief chat I had with the owner it seems they pick out cars with good history and apparently check out the servicw records from main dealers etc before advertising. I wouldn't write them off solely just because they are in Bradford.
